Can't ping the floating IP of an instance

asked 2016-03-22

kvasko gravatar image

updated 2016-03-22

Bipin gravatar image

I just create and OS deployment with fuel with 1 controller and 1 compute node. I can launch an instance (oddly enough Admin account can't but another account can) and it boots correctly. Within the Cirros instance I can ping my public gateway, and the internet ( However, I cannot ping the instances public floating IP (e.g. from my laptop ( The firewall/security within Openstack is accepting everything. I can even ping my laptop from Cirros (the openstack instance). I can login to the router namespaces on the controller and can ping stuff without an issue. Not sure where to look from here on debugging this issue.

I realize this topic seems to come up a lot and I tried those suggestions but none of them worked. Any suggestions?
Add ICMP rules anyway and see what happens.

rl_person ( 2016-03-23 )

I'll try that. I did explicitly add the rule to allow SSH and could not SSH either.

kvasko ( 2016-03-23 )

@rl_person I explicitly added the ICMP and SSH rules to the default security group (instances is part of the default group) and it did not work. However, when I added the rules to the entire CIDR public range I was able to get to the instances public ip. Any reason security group would not work?

kvasko ( 2016-03-23 )

answered 2020-03-30

dgolive gravatar image


Can help someone:

In my env was working well and without reason my the floating ip cannot ping and was solved restarting the neutron-l3-agent in all compute nodes.

systemctl restart neutron-l3-agent

answered 2017-04-10

mehdi92 gravatar image

I m having the same issue here, did you find a solution ?

answered 2017-04-11

Simone Cesar gravatar image

Your laptop is on the same VLAN of the external network ?

Asked: 2016-03-22 22:36:27 -0500

Seen: 1,758 times

Last updated: Apr 10 '17